Transaction 8f00cc0533b3cbeb120e90253dea20c607141cb3ffaaf76082893a4d29759487

1 Input
2 Outputs
  • 8f00cc0533b3cbeb120e90253dea20c607141cb3ffaaf76082893a4d29759487:0
  • value  295347784
    address  17sWusKmUEABF1ARhuAPhkWtj2mFcDNpMK
  • 8f00cc0533b3cbeb120e90253dea20c607141cb3ffaaf76082893a4d29759487:1
  • value  2308684
    address  1EZHma9WrUf2UTUE8Sn8FCTS9iND6z5xDa